# File 'lib/train/platforms/detect/helpers/os_windows.rb', line 5

def detect_windows
  # try to detect windows, use cmd.exe to also support Microsoft OpenSSH
  res = @backend.run_command('cmd.exe /c ver')
  return false if res.exit_status != 0 or res.stdout.empty?

  # if the ver contains `Windows`, we know its a Windows system
  version = res.stdout.strip
  return false unless version.downcase =~ /windows/
  @platform[:family] = 'windows'

  # try to extract release from eg. `Microsoft Windows [Version 6.3.9600]`
  release = /\[(?<name>.*)\]/.match(version)
  unless release[:name].nil?
    # release is 6.3.9600 now
    @platform[:release] = release[:name].downcase.gsub('version', '').strip
    # fallback, if we are not able to extract the name from wmic later
    @platform[:name] = "Windows #{@platform[:release]}"
  end

  # try to use wmic, but lets keep it optional
  read_wmic

  true
end

# File 'lib/train/platforms/detect/helpers/os_windows.rb', line 33

def read_wmic
  res = @backend.run_command('wmic os get * /format:list')
  if res.exit_status == 0
    sys_info = {}
    res.stdout.lines.each { |line|
      m = /^\s*([^=]*?)\s*=\s*(.*?)\s*$/.match(line)
      sys_info[m[1].to_sym] = m[2] unless m.nil? || m[1].nil?
    }

    @platform[:release] = sys_info[:Version]
    # additional info on windows
    @platform[:build] = sys_info[:BuildNumber]
    @platform[:name] = sys_info[:Caption]
    @platform[:name] = @platform[:name].gsub('Microsoft', '').strip unless @platform[:name].empty?
    @platform[:arch] = read_wmic_cpu
  end
end

# File 'lib/train/platforms/detect/helpers/os_windows.rb', line 53

def read_wmic_cpu
  res = @backend.run_command('wmic cpu get architecture /format:list')
  if res.exit_status == 0
    sys_info = {}
    res.stdout.lines.each { |line|
      m = /^\s*([^=]*?)\s*=\s*(.*?)\s*$/.match(line)
      sys_info[m[1].to_sym] = m[2] unless m.nil? || m[1].nil?
    }
  end

  # This converts `wmic os get architecture` output to a normal standard
  # https://msdn.microsoft.com/en-us/library/aa394373(VS.85).aspx
  arch_map = {
    0 => 'i386',
    1 => 'mips',
    2 => 'alpha',
    3 => 'powerpc',
    5 => 'arm',
    6 => 'ia64',
    9 => 'x86_64',
  }

  # The value of `wmic cpu get architecture` is always a number between 0-9
  arch_number = sys_info[:Architecture].to_i
  arch_map[arch_number]
end

#windows_uuidObject

This method scans the target os for a unique uuid to use

# File 'lib/train/platforms/detect/helpers/os_windows.rb', line 81

def windows_uuid
  uuid = windows_uuid_from_chef
  uuid = windows_uuid_from_machine_file if uuid.nil?
  uuid = windows_uuid_from_wmic if uuid.nil?
  uuid = windows_uuid_from_registry if uuid.nil?
  raise Train::TransportError, 'Cannot find a UUID for your node.' if uuid.nil?
  uuid
end

# File 'lib/train/platforms/detect/helpers/os_windows.rb', line 114

def windows_uuid_from_registry
  cmd = '(Get-ItemProperty "Registry::HKEY_LOCAL_MACHINE\SOFTWARE\Microsoft\Cryptography" -Name "MachineGuid")."MachineGuid"'
  result = @backend.run_command(cmd)
  return unless result.exit_status.zero?
  result.stdout.chomp
end

# File 'lib/train/platforms/detect/helpers/os_windows.rb', line 108

def windows_uuid_from_wmic
  result = @backend.run_command('wmic csproduct get UUID')
  return unless result.exit_status.zero?
  result.stdout.split("\r\n")[-1].strip
end
